Flow: OpenText DAM (OTMM) to Sprinklr
Marketing teams store approved product images, campaign visuals, and short-form videos in OpenText DAM (OTMM), then publish them directly into Sprinklr for social scheduling and channel distribution. This ensures social teams always use the latest approved creative without manually searching shared drives or requesting files from design teams.
Flow: Bi-directional
When a campaign is planned in Sprinklr, the associated creative brief, channel plan, and publishing calendar can reference assets stored in OpenText DAM (OTMM). If a new version of an image or video is approved in OTMM, Sprinklr can be updated automatically so regional teams always work from the current version.
Flow: OpenText DAM (OTMM) to Sprinklr
For product launches, OTMM serves as the source of truth for product photography, lifestyle imagery, and launch videos. Sprinklr pulls these assets into social publishing and advertising workflows so teams can quickly deploy launch content across organic social, paid social, and regional channel variants.
Flow: OpenText DAM (OTMM) to Sprinklr
Customer care agents using Sprinklr can access approved product images, how-to visuals, and instructional videos from OTMM when responding to customer questions on social channels. This is especially useful for complex products, warranty issues, setup guidance, or troubleshooting steps that benefit from visual support.
Flow: Sprinklr to OpenText DAM (OTMM)
Sprinklr analytics can identify which images, videos, and creative variants perform best across social and digital channels. That performance data can be pushed back to OTMM and associated with the original assets so creative and marketing teams can reuse high-performing content and retire underperforming variants.
Flow: Bi-directional
For regulated industries or sensitive campaigns, assets can be approved in OpenText DAM (OTMM) before being made available in Sprinklr. Sprinklr can then enforce publishing workflows so only approved content is scheduled or promoted. If an asset is rejected or replaced in OTMM, the change can be reflected in Sprinklr to prevent accidental use.
Flow: OpenText DAM (OTMM) to Sprinklr
Photos and videos from company events, trade shows, or museum and heritage activities can be ingested into OTMM, tagged, and approved for reuse. Sprinklr then distributes selected event assets across social channels in near real time to support live coverage, post-event recaps, and audience engagement.
Flow: OpenText DAM (OTMM) to Sprinklr
Sprinklr teams managing social, advertising, and customer engagement can access a structured library of product images, campaign visuals, and video assets from OTMM to support multiple use cases from one source. This reduces the need for separate content stores and helps teams maintain a consistent brand presence across organic, paid, and care interactions.
